华为云国际站代理商:c语句连接sql数据库

华为云国际站代理商:C语句连接SQL数据库

华为云的优势

Huawei Cloud是华为技术有限公司推出的一款领先的云计算服务平台,具有以下优势:

1. 强大的性能和可靠性

Huawei Cloud采用华为自主研发的鲲鹏处理器,具有卓越的性能表现。同时,华为云还拥有多个数据中心,实现了高可靠性和冗余备份,确保客户业务的稳定运行。

2. 全球覆盖的服务网络

Huawei Cloud在全球范围内部署了多个数据中心,能够提供低延迟的云服务。无论用户身在何处,都能够享受到华为云提供的高效、稳定的服务。

3. 完善的安全防护措施

Huawei Cloud采用多层次的安全防护措施,包括访问控制、数据加密、DDoS防护等,保障用户数据的安全性。同时,华为还拥有专业的安全团队,能够及时应对各类安全威胁。

C语句连接SQL数据库

C语言是一种强大的编程语言,能够与各种数据库进行交互。下面我们通过几个步骤,介绍如何使用C语言连接SQL数据库。

1. 引入头文件

C语言连接SQL数据库需要引入相应的头文件,例如:

#include <mysql.h>

2. 建立连接

使用mysql_init()函数初始化一个MYSQL结构体,并使用mysql_real_connect()函数建立与数据库的连接。需要提供数据库主机名、用户名、密码等信息。

MYSQL *conn;
conn = mysql_init(NULL);
if (mysql_real_connect(conn, "localhost", "user", "password", "database", 0, NULL, 0) == NULL) {
    fprintf(stderr, "%sn", mysql_error(conn));
    exit(1);
}

3. 执行SQL语句

使用mysql_query()函数执行SQL语句,例如查询操作:

if (mysql_query(conn, "SELECT * FROM table")) {
    fprintf(stderr, "%sn", mysql_error(conn));
    exit(1);
}

4. 处理结果

使用mysql_store_result()函数获取查询结果,并使用mysql_fetch_row()函数逐行读取结果。

华为云国际站代理商:c语句连接sql数据库

MYSQL_RES *result;
MYSQL_ROW row;

result = mysql_store_result(conn);
while ((row = mysql_fetch_row(result))) {
    printf("%sn", row[0]);
}
mysql_free_result(result);

5. 关闭连接

使用mysql_close()函数关闭与数据库的连接。

mysql_close(conn);

总结

本文介绍了华为云的优势以及如何使用C语言连接SQL数据库的步骤。华为云凭借强大的性能和可靠性、全球覆盖的服务网络以及完善的安全防护措施,成为了代理商首选的云计算服务平台。使用C语言连接SQL数据库可以通过引入头文件、建立连接、执行SQL语句、处理结果以及关闭连接等步骤来完成。希望本文对你了解华为云的优势和使用C语言连接SQL数据库有所帮助。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/184761.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年6月14日 19:41
下一篇 2024年6月14日 20:35

相关推荐

  • 华为云国际站代理商:服务器在线监控

    华为云国际站代理商:服务器在线监控 引言 随着数字化转型的不断推进,企业对IT基础设施的依赖日益加深。华为云作为全球领先的云计算服务提供商,凭借其强大的技术实力和丰富的产品线,成为了众多企业的首选。本文将探讨华为云在服务器在线监控方面的优势,帮助企业更好地管理和维护其云环境。 华为云的技术优势 华为云凭借其强大的技术背景和研发能力,提供了一系列先进的云服务,…

    2024年11月3日
    9500
  • 华为云国际站代理商注册:cdn请求头部信息

    华为云国际站代理商注册:CDN请求头部信息解析与应用 随着云计算技术的快速发展,越来越多的企业开始借助云服务提升自己的业务能力。华为云作为国内领先的云服务提供商,近年来逐渐在国际市场取得了一定的影响力。为了进一步拓展市场,华为云提供了国际站代理商注册服务,同时也为代理商提供了包括内容分发网络(CDN)在内的多种云服务解决方案。 本文将详细探讨华为云国际站代理…

    2024年11月13日
    12600
  • 华为云代理商:分布式缓存服务用谁的好

    华为云代理商选择分布式缓存服务的最佳方案 在现代互联网时代,分布式缓存已成为企业高效存储和数据管理的关键技术。选择合适的分布式缓存服务不仅有助于提升数据处理速度,还能降低运营成本。本文将介绍华为云分布式缓存服务的优势,帮助企业在选择代理商时做出明智决定。 一、分布式缓存的必要性 分布式缓存服务主要解决数据存储和访问中的延迟问题,适用于电商、游戏、金融等需要处…

    2024年10月28日
    15900
  • 邯郸华为云代理商:android文字识别sdk

    邯郸华为云代理商:Android文字识别SDK 引言 随着科技的不断发展,人工智能技术正逐渐渗透到我们的日常生活中。其中,文字识别技术作为人工智能技术的一种具有广泛应用领域,包括但不限于身份证识别、车牌识别、文字翻译等。 华为云优势 作为全球领先的云计算服务提供商,华为云提供了丰富的人工智能技术和服务,其中包括文字识别SDK。华为云的文字识别SDK具有以下优…

    2024年3月23日
    22000
  • 华为云国际站代理商:cdn浏览器缓存时间

    华为云国际站代理商:CDN浏览器缓存时间的优化与管理 随着互联网技术的不断发展,网站访问速度和用户体验成为了现代企业竞争中的重要因素之一。在全球化的网络环境中,如何提升网站的响应速度、降低用户等待时间,成为了许多企业亟待解决的难题。而内容分发网络(CDN)作为一种有效的技术手段,通过分布式缓存技术,极大地优化了网站性能和访问速度。本文将详细探讨华为云国际站作…

    2024年11月20日
    13900

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/